OutLawTorn Posted January 14, 2008 Posted January 14, 2008 Been playing Tabula Rasa lately... using the surname "Caedus" on the Cassiopeia server (West Coast US based). For those who don't know, its a sci-fi based mmorpg and it uses a common "surname" to link your characters (This is because you can clone youself at any time to create new characters, so if you have a level 30, but want to try a new path, you clone it and then skill up, you don't have to start from scratch )
